Roman Emperor Zeno : the perils of power politics in fifth-century Constantinople /

"Peter Crawford examines the life and career of the fifth-century Roman emperor Zeno and the various problems he faced before and during his seventeen-year rule. Despite its length, his reign has hitherto been somewhat overlooked as being just a part of that gap between Theodosian and Justiniac...
